Introduction

Brazilian sugaring is an ancient hair removal technique that has gained immense popularity in recent years. Unlike traditional waxing, sugaring uses a paste made from sugar, lemon juice, and water to gently remove hair from the root. This method is renowned for its less painful experience, effective results, and numerous skin benefits.

Benefits of Brazilian Sugaring

1. Less Painful Than Waxing:

Sugaring paste has a unique consistency that adheres to the hair shaft rather than the skin. As a result, it pulls away the hair more cleanly, reducing the intense pain associated with waxing.

2. Exfoliates and Moisturizes the Skin:

The sugaring paste acts as a gentle exfoliator, removing dead skin cells and revealing smoother, brighter skin. Additionally, the lemon juice and water in the paste hydrate the skin, leaving it feeling soft and supple.

3. Slows Down Hair Growth:

Over time, regular sugaring sessions can weaken the hair shaft, leading to slower and thinner hair growth. The hair follicles are gradually damaged, resulting in longer periods between hair removal appointments.

4. Reduces Ingrown Hairs and Irritation:

Unlike shaving, which often causes ingrown hairs and razor burn, sugaring removes hair in the direction of its growth. This prevents broken hairs and the formation of unsightly bumps.

5. No Chemical Irritants:

Sugaring paste is made from natural ingredients, free of harsh chemicals that can irritate the skin. It is an excellent option for sensitive skin types and individuals with allergies.

How Brazilian Sugaring Works

The sugaring process involves applying a warm, pliable sugaring paste to the desired area. The paste is then left to cool slightly before it is removed in the opposite direction of hair growth. This effectively removes the hair from the root, leaving the skin smooth and hair-free.

Brazilian Sugaring for Different Areas

Sugaring can be used to remove hair from various body areas, including:

  • Face: For eyebrows, upper lip, and chin hair
  • Bikini line: For pubic hair removal
  • Legs: For calf, thigh, and knee hair
  • Underarms: For armpit hair removal
  • Other areas: Such as the back, chest, and fingers

Choosing a Reputable Salon

It is crucial to choose a reputable salon with experienced and certified sugarists. They will ensure proper hygiene practices and use high-quality sugaring paste. Here are some factors to consider when selecting a salon:

  • Reviews and recommendations: Read online reviews and ask for referrals from friends or family.
  • Trained professionals: Make sure the sugarists are professionally trained and have a strong understanding of the sugaring technique.
  • Hygiene standards: Observe the cleanliness of the salon and ensure they follow proper sterilization procedures.
  • Product quality: Inquire about the quality of the sugaring paste used and its ingredients.

Precautions and Aftercare

  • Avoid sun exposure: Limit sun exposure before and after sugaring to prevent skin irritation.
  • Exfoliate regularly: Gently exfoliate the skin a few days before and after sugaring to remove dead skin cells and ensure smooth hair removal.
  • Moisturize: Apply a soothing moisturizer to the sugared area to keep the skin hydrated.
  • Avoid hot showers and saunas: High temperatures can irritate the skin after sugaring.
  • Wear loose clothing: Opt for loose-fitting clothes to prevent irritation and friction on the sugared area.

Comparison with Other Hair Removal Methods

Method Pain Level Exfoliating Ability Hair Growth Reduction Ingrown Hair Risk Chemical Irritants
Brazilian Sugaring Low to moderate Yes Yes Low None
Waxing High Minimal Minimal High Possible
Shaving Low No No High Possible
Laser Hair Removal Varies No Significant Low Possible

Tips for a Comfortable Experience

  • Take a warm bath or shower: Prepare your skin by taking a warm bath or shower to soften the hair and open up the pores.
  • Exfoliate: Gently exfoliate the area to be sugared to remove dead skin cells.
  • Use a talc-free powder: Sprinkle a small amount of talc-free powder on the skin to absorb excess moisture and improve the paste's grip.
  • Take deep breaths: Relax and take deep breaths during the sugaring process to minimize discomfort.
  • Apply pressure: Apply firm pressure when removing the paste to ensure all hairs are removed cleanly.
  • Avoid sugaring during menstruation: Hormone fluctuations during this time can make the skin more sensitive.

Conclusion

Brazilian sugaring offers a gentle and effective solution for hair removal, leaving the skin smoother, brighter, and hair-free for an extended period. By choosing a reputable salon and following the proper aftercare instructions, you can ensure a comfortable and satisfying sugaring experience. Embrace the benefits of this ancient hair removal technique and enjoy the confidence that comes with smooth, hairless skin.
